What is the purpose of including a works cited or bibliography page?

The purpose of the Works Cited page is to collect all of the sources used in a text and to arrange them so they are easy for your reader to locate. Listing the sources also helps you track them and makes it less likely that you might accidentally plagiarize by forgetting to mention a piece of source material.

Does a bibliography include works not cited?

If you have been asked to include a reference list, you may also include a bibliography which lists works that you have read but not cited. A bibliography lists all the sources you used when researching your assignment.

How many works cited should I have?

Regarding the number of reference citations, there is no specific number or range that is considered as normal or standard. You should cite just about enough sources that are required for your paper. The number of references you will use depends on how much literature exists on the topic.

Are bibliography and works cited page the same thing?

Works cited and bibliography are not the same thing . While in Works Cited you only list items you have referred to and cited in your paper but a bibliography lists all of the material you have consulted in preparing your essay whether or not you have referred to and cited the work.

How do you make works cited page?

Follow these rules to create your Works Cited page: 1. Begin your Works Cited Page on a new page, with the title Works Cited centered at the top. 2. Doublespace within and between the citations. 3. Put your citations in alphabetical order by the first word of each (usually the author’s last name).
